Abstract
The paper presents control system of a working chamber load of an electromagnetic mill. The mill works in a dry grinding and classification circuit with pneumatic transport. Structure of the circuit is presented in the paper as well as the measurement system. Data acquisition uses direct and indirect measurements. The most challenging are the indirect measurement of the chamber fulfillment and the grinding media load which require special methodology. The proposed approach is explained and exemplary data are presented in the paper. Structure of the control system is described together with the implementation at a semi-industrial plant.
